A local bakery sells cupcakes and cookies. The cost of a cupcake is $2 and the cost of a cookie is $1. If a customer buys a total of 10 items for $16, how many cupcakes and cookies did they buy?

4 cupcakes and 6 cookies

5 cupcakes and 5 cookies

6 cupcakes and 4 cookies

7 cupcakes and 3 cookies

A car rental company charges a flat fee of $30 plus $0.20 per mile driven. Another company charges $25 plus $0.25 per mile. How many miles must you drive for the costs to be the same?

75 miles

50 miles

120 miles

100 miles

Two friends are saving money to buy a video game. Friend A saves $5 a week, while Friend B saves $3 a week. If Friend A starts with $10 and Friend B starts with $20, how many weeks will it take for them to have the same amount of money?

10 weeks

3 weeks

5 weeks

7 weeks

A school is selling tickets for a play. Adult tickets cost $8 and student tickets cost $5. If they sold a total of 50 tickets for $320, how many adult and student tickets were sold?

25 adult tickets and 25 student tickets

15 adult tickets and 35 student tickets

10 adult tickets and 40 student tickets

20 adult tickets and 30 student tickets
